#383d4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#383d4d is composed of 22% red, 23.9%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.3% cyan, 20.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 225.7 degrees, a saturation of 15.8% and a lightness of 26.1%. #383d4d color hex could be obtained by blending #707a9a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#383d4d color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#383d4d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#383d4d has RGB values of R:56, G:61,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 3685709.
